操作系统课程设计

以下是为您整理出来关于【操作系统课程设计】合集内容,如果觉得还不错,请帮忙转发推荐。

【操作系统课程设计】技术教程文章

操作系统课程设计 编译Linux内核【图】

实验编号课程设计专题一题目编译Linux内核实验目的1.什么是Linux内核 2.从内核源码到内核image 3.GNU make和makefile 4.操作系统引导程序5.Linux内核的引导 实验内容验收材料要求:新内核引导成功前:1. 执行命令:uname –a,提交截屏结果1新内核引导成功后:2. 执行命令:uname –a,提交截屏结果23. 进入目录/boot,执行命令:ls -l,提交截屏结果3报告内容要求(1) 程序实现方法和思路(2) 测试及结果报 告 正 文(1)1.内核,是一个...

操作系统课程设计2 进程调度算法【代码】【图】

进程调度算法的分析、设计与实现(110) 一、 本实验采用的调度算法设计理论描述(10分)FCFS(先来先服务):当在进程调度中采用该算法时,系统将按照进程到达的先后顺序来进行调度,或者说它是优先考虑在系统中等待时间最长的进程,而不管该进程所需执行的时间的长短,从后备队列中选择几个最先进入该队列的进程,将他们调入内存,为他们分配资源和创建进程,然后把它放入就绪队列。每次调度是从就绪的进程队列中选择一个最先进入...

河北大学操作系统课程设计进程管理c#(一)【图】

操作系统要结课了,老师让我们做一个课程设计,进程管理系统。之前没接触过c#,一点点做吧。 这里先把页面设计好吧。.net的窗体还是挺好用的,不过弄这个就废了我挺长时间。 先看效果图: 这些控件的name是: 开机:open_button 关机:close_button 当前时间:local_time 内存使用:memory_use 当前进程:process_name 优先级:process_dengji 执行指令:instruction 中间结果:middle_result 运行时间:running_time 时间片:tim...

操作系统课程设计之银行家算法【代码】【图】

操作系统课程设计之银行家算法 背景 银行家算法(Banker’s Algorithm)是一个避免死锁(Deadlock)的著名算法,是由艾兹格迪杰斯特拉在1965年为T.H.E系统设计的一种避免死锁产生的算法。它以银行借贷系统的分配策略为基础,判断并保证系统的安全运行。 在银行中,客户申请贷款的数量是有限的,每个客户在第一次申请贷款时要声明完成该项目所需的最大资金量,在满足所有贷款要求时,客户应及时归还。银行家在客户申请的贷款数量不超...